VINCI SA (VINCI) is an integrated construction and concessions firm. It performs design, construction and infrastructure management and facilities at a global scale. The company's portfolio of services comprises design and coordination, infrastructure development, civil and hydraulic engineering, consultancy, maintenance and technical support services for transport infrastructure and public facilities. VINCI builds public and private buildings, energy, transport systems, airport and urban development, and water, energy, and communication network projects. VINCI also executes transport infrastructure concession operations across airports, motorway, stadium, rail, bridge and tunnel, and parking facility sectors. The company has presence across Africa, Europe, the Americas, Asia, and the Middle East.

In July 2019, VINCI Immobilier launched a venture investment company focused on real estate startups. VINCI Immobilier is a real estate developer and VINCI's subsidiary. Through this Corporate Fund Venture, the company aims to identify and finance startups providing innovative technology solutions that align with its asset management and real estate development initiatives.

In December 2017, VINCI's innovation platform, Leonard, collaborated with six other corporate groups and 101 experts in the field of artificial intelligence to create Hub France IA. It is a collaborative association aimed at creating a French AI sector that brings together all the players currently building, offering, or inclined towards artificial intelligence solutions.

In 2019, VINCI Airports began a program in order to further strengthen its digital innovation strategy. As part of this program, three airports are selected with a specific area of expertise. The program aims to develop and test innovations that have the potential to be rolled out to other airports in VINCI's network. The three airports selected are London Lyon - Saint Exupery (for passenger experience); Lisbon (for passenger flow management); and Gatwick (for improving runway operations). This program facilitates testing of artificial intelligence, automation, and biometrics etc. related applications aligned with the airport operations. The company also has innovation center for Highways and Electronic Tolling at Peru. The center works towards modernizing the road infrastructure.

In July 2017, VINCI launched Leonard to identify and accelerate innovative business projects carried out by the company's employees. Leonard focuses on developing innovative ideas related to construction, mobility, real estate, retail, or sustainable cities. In May 2020, Leonard partnered with CEMEX Ventures' 2020 Construction Startup Competition to identify and support startups providing innovative solutions in the construction sector. In Nov 2019, Leonard created a five-month AI program that specifically supports artificial intelligence projects conceived by any of the VINCI's entity. In Jul 2019, Leonard launched two programs called SEED and CATALYST to facilitate collaboration between VINCI and external startups. SEED's duration is six months, and it supports startups in product development and receiving their first round of funding. CATALYST is a six-month program that provides mentorship and funding support to innovative startups and SMEs whose offerings are related to VINCI's business lines.

In 2017, VINCI Energies launched an international hackathon called Human Beyond Digital Hack. The hackathon comprises three challenges: Data science and machine learning for detection of frauds; 3D visualization of IoT data; and behavior detection.

In 2017, VINCI Autoroutes set up a Digital Factory to support and develop innovative ideas within the company. It works in collaborative with operational management division of the company and encourages all the employees to present, build, and lead their ideas into a fully functional technological business offering.

In June 2016, VINCI Energies introduced Inerbiz, a financial and managerial investment fund to support startups offering innovative solutions in the energy sector. Inerbiz allows VINCI Energies to expand into new technologies as well as assist its clients in energy transition and digital transformation. Through this investment fund, VINCI Energies develops long-term business and industrial partnerships with startups providing them opportunities to develop and test their prototypes.

  • VINCI leverages Building Information Management models to carry out modular construction projects and enhance operational efficiencies of its business divisions. VINCI Facilities implemented BIM digital models for technical maintenance, data transfer, real-time collaboration, and 3D visualization of building projects. VINCI Construction's digital services business, Sixense, deployed BIM models for precise 3D cross-sectional extraction of building sections. VINCI is also adopting Building Operating System as its key construction approach for leveraging a smart building mechanism.
  • VINCI implemented Oracle Human Capital Management cloud solution as part of Project Vitalis. Oracle HCM provides integrated HR transformation solutions that optimize end-to-end processes including hiring, talent management, payroll, and workforce management across the clients' geographical operations and organizational divisions like finance, customer experience, supply chain, etc.
  • VINCI is implementing automation procedures in order to bring efficiency and safety to its waste removal processes. Neom, a subsidiary of VINCI Construction France, introduced robotic processes for waste removal from construction sites without any human intervention. Neom specializes in demolition and lead removal, asbestos removal, cleaning and plumbing procedures across construction sites in France.
  • VINCI is implementing blockchain technology for enhancing its supply chain efficiency. VINCI Construction UK along with Skanska, BRE, nPlan, and Assentian began working on development of a blockchain-based digital planning and supply chain management toolbox called PLASMA. The PLASMA toolbox was aimed at improving the productivity of construction procedures through better project planning, supply chain collaboration, and analysis of the data related to construction projects.
